Robber Who Mugged 85-Year-Old Calls Police to Protest Innocence – After Being Named by Public

Heartless Thief Targets Elderly Woman in Broad Daylight

Jacob Harper, 31, was caught red-handed snatching an 85-year-old lady’s handbag as she shopped. CCTV shows Harper leaning from his bike to grab the bag, sending the poor woman crashing to the ground. Thankfully, she wasn’t seriously hurt but left shaken by the vicious attack.

Public Outcry and False Claims of Innocence

Harper was soon identified following a media appeal, sparking a flood of calls and social media messages both naming him and some bizarrely defending his innocence. In a cheeky move, Harper himself rang the police control room to claim he was innocent – despite the damning evidence.

Police Furious at ‘Cowardly and Opportunistic’ Crime

Detective Constable Hollie Fothergill slammed the mugging as “a cowardly and opportunistic attack on an elderly woman who was simply doing her shopping.” She added:

“Harper, who clearly identified her as an easy target, left her sprawled on the ground, putting her in danger of serious injury. His actions that day were heinous, and I am relieved that he has now been brought to justice.”

She also thanked the victim and her family for their “patience and dignity throughout the legal process” and expressed hope that the sentence handed down would bring them closure.

Denial Doesn’t Hold Up in Court

Despite admitting in interview to riding a silver Carrera bike around town that day, Harper denied being on it during the theft. The Nottingham Crown Court heard the evidence on 29 July, where Harper’s lies were laid bare.
